What is the Infracost MCP Server?
Connect Infracost to your AI agent to bring financial visibility and governance to your Infrastructure as Code (IaC) workflows. Prevent cloud cost surprises before they happen.
What you can do
- Cost Guardrails — List, create, and manage guardrails that trigger alerts or block Pull Requests when cost increases exceed your defined thresholds.
- Tagging Governance — Enforce organizational standards by updating tagging policies, ensuring all cloud resources are correctly attributed to departments or projects.
- Custom Pricing — Manage enterprise-specific price books for AWS and Azure to ensure cost estimates reflect your actual negotiated discounts.
- Business Context — Upload custom properties from external systems like ServiceNow or Backstage to map cloud costs to your internal organizational hierarchy.
- Pricing Queries — Programmatically query cloud pricing data to compare costs across different resource types and regions.

Frequently asked questions
How can I see all active cost guardrails for my organization?
You can use the list_guardrails tool by providing your organization slug. The agent will return a list of all configured thresholds, including cost increase limits and whether they block PRs.
Can I enforce mandatory tags for my cloud resources using this server?
Yes! Use the update_tagging_policy tool to define mandatory tag keys and allowed values. This helps maintain standards across all your repositories.
Is it possible to block expensive Pull Requests automatically?
Absolutely. When using create_guardrail or update_guardrail, you can set the blockPr parameter to true. This ensures that any infrastructure change exceeding your budget cannot be merged without review.
